Abstract

An image retargeting method and apparatus for increasing or reducing an image ratio are disclosed. The present embodiment provides an image retargeting method and apparatus for: increasing an image ratio by acquiring an image in which a line extracted from an energy map for an area, that excludes the area to be preserved in an input image, is inserted; or reducing the image ratio by acquiring a line deletion image extracted from an energy map for an area that excludes the area to be preserved in a correct answer image.
